The launch of v10 is a major milestone, but the developer has hinted that this is only the beginning. The roadmap includes plans for more islands to explore, new animals to hunt (or be hunted by), and even deeper RPG progression systems. The community is actively growing, and the developer is known for listening to player feedback. The next major update is rumored to include a cooperative multiplayer mode, allowing you to survive the island with friends.
